Draeger - Infinity PiCCO SmartPod
DESCRIPTION
Provides less invasive, beat-to-beat hemodynamic and volumetric monitoring.Now you can monitor hemodynamic and volumetric parameters without a pulmonary artery catheter, using the Infinity PiCCO SmartPod. The device can integrate four invasive pressures and cardiac output using a single cable that connects the pod to the monitor.

FEATURES
[list] Supports a wide variety of parameters including: [*] Pulse Contour Cardiac Output (PCCO) [*] Continuous Cardiac Index (PCCI) [*] Stroke Volume (p-SV0 [*] Stroke Volume Index (p-SVI) [*] Stroke Volume Variation (SVV) [*] Systemic Vascular Resistance (p-SVR) [*] Systemic Vascular Resistance Index (p-SVRI) [*] Pulse Pressure Variation (PPV) [*] Index of Left Ventricular Contractility (dPmax)1 [*] Cardiac Output (p-CO) [*] Cardiac Index (p-CI) [*] Cardiac Function Index (CFI) [*] Global End Diastolic Volume (GEDV) [*] Global End Diastolic Volume Index (GEDVI) [*] Extra Vascular Lung Water (EVLW)1 [*] Extra Vascular Lung Water Index (EVLWI)1 [*] Global Ejection Fraction (GEF)1 [*] Pulmonary Vascular Permeability Index (PVPI)1 [*] Arterial Pressure, Systolic, Diastolic and Mean (ART) [*] Intrathovacic Blood Volume (ITBV) [*] Intrathovacic Blood Volume Index (ITBVI) [*] Determines parameters both intermittently and continuously - PiCCO technology uses quantitative parameters that are determined both intermittently through PULSION’s transpulmonary thermodilution technique and continuously through arterial pulse contour analysis [/list]
